Linux下的软件包管理系统使用教程:如何快速安装和更新软件

时间:2025-12-15 分类:操作系统

在当今信息技术飞速发展的时代,Linux操作系统因其稳定性和安全性被广泛应用于服务器和个人电脑中。使用Linux的用户常常需要安装或更新软件,而这时一个高效的软件包管理系统就显得尤为重要。通过掌握Linux下的软件包管理工具,用户可以以最简单的方式快速安装所需软件,保持系统的最新状态。这不仅提升了工作效率,也保证了系统的安全性与稳定性。无论是新手用户还是有经验的开发者,了解这些工具的使用方法对日常维护和软件管理至关重要。

Linux下的软件包管理系统使用教程:如何快速安装和更新软件

当前主流的Linux发行版中,软件包管理系统主要分为两大类:基于Debian的管理系统(如Ubuntu)和基于Red Hat的管理系统(如CentOS)。对于Debian系的用户,通常使用`apt`命令进行软件管理,而Red Hat系的用户则常用`yum`或`dnf`命令。掌握这些基本命令是进行软件安装和更新的基础。

对于Debian系用户,如果需要安装软件,可以打开终端并输入以下命令:

bash

sudo apt update

sudo apt install 软件名称

第一个命令会更新软件源列表,确保您得到的是最新的软件版本。第二个命令则会开始安装指定的软件。使用`apt upgrade`命令可以快速更新所有已安装的软件包,确保系统安全性与最新性。

对于Red Hat系用户,安装软件的步骤稍有不同,通常会使用以下命令:

bash

sudo yum install 软件名称

使用`yum update`则可更新所有软件包。近年来,`dnf`逐渐取代了`yum`,提供更快的性能和更好的依赖性管理。使用时,只需将`yum`替换为`dnf`即可。

除了上述基本命令,用户还可以通过图形化界面来管理软件。例如,Ubuntu提供的软件中心允许用户在可视化界面中搜索、安装和更新软件,使操作更加简单直观。对于更高级的用户,则可以探索其他程序包管理工具,如`snap`或`flatpak`,它们能够跨发行版部署应用,提供更强大的灵活性与兼容性。

在使用Linux软件包管理系统时,建议定期清理不必要的包和缓存,以释放硬盘空间。通过执行`sudo apt autoremove`和`sudo apt clean`(对于Debian系用户)或`sudo yum clean all`(对于Red Hat系用户)指令,用户可以保持系统的整洁与高效运行。

熟悉Linux下的软件包管理系统是保证系统高效运行的重要环节。通过掌握相关命令和工具,用户能够更轻松地管理软件,提高工作效率,从而更好地利用Linux操作系统的强大功能。无论是初学者还是有经验的用户,掌握这些技能都将为日常使用提供极大的便利。